The University of Southern California (USC) is seeking an innovative and collaborative Web Developer Supervisor to lead digital communications and customer experience initiatives across the institution. This role is responsible for overseeing how information is communicated through web and digital technologies while partnering with university leaders to develop strategies that enhance engagement, accessibility, and the user experience.

The ideal candidate combines strong technical expertise with strategic communication skills and a passion for human-centered design. This leader will guide cross-functional teams, manage digital communication initiatives, and champion technology solutions that improve how audiences access information and interact with university resources.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and implement engagement and digital communication strategies aligned with university goals and culture.

  • Lead customer and user experience initiatives focused on accessibility, usability, and effective communication delivery.

  • Oversee web and digital communication platforms, ensuring high-quality content, functionality, and user engagement.

  • Collaborate with university leaders and stakeholders to develop customer experience visions and communication strategies.

  • Gather and analyze audience interaction and engagement data to improve communication effectiveness and digital experiences.

  • Develop segmentation strategies and user personas to better understand and serve university audiences.

  • Establish communication governance standards, procedures, quality controls, and performance metrics.

  • Drive innovation in digital communications by introducing new technologies, tools, and communication approaches.

  • Supervise staff and/or student workers, providing coaching, performance management, and professional development.

  • Manage multiple concurrent projects, timelines, and organizational priorities effectively.

  • Support continuous improvement of communication systems, workflows, and digital platforms.

  • Promote a collaborative and inclusive workplace culture aligned with university values and ethics.

About USC

USC is a leading private research university located in the heart of downtown Los Angeles – a global center for arts, technology and international business. As the largest private employer in the city – responsible for more than $5 billion annually in economic activity in the region – we offer the opportunity to work in a dynamic and diverse environment, in careers that span a broad spectrum of talents and skills.
